Church gutter replacement services involve removing old, damaged, or ineffective gutters and installing new systems to better manage rainwater runoff. This process typically includes assessing the existing gutter setup, removing any compromised sections, and securely installing new gutters that fit the property’s specific needs. Proper installation ensures that water flows smoothly away from the building’s foundation, preventing potential water damage and structural issues. Service providers may also include installing or updating downspouts and gutter guards to improve overall performance and longevity of the system.
Replacing gutters can help address common problems such as leaks, overflowing water, sagging, or detached sections. When gutters become clogged or damaged, they can cause water to spill over the sides, leading to erosion around the foundation, basement flooding, or damage to siding and landscaping. Old or improperly installed gutters may also develop leaks or become detached during heavy storms, increasing the risk of water-related issues. Gutter replacement helps restore effective water diversion, protecting the property’s integrity and reducing the need for cost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Church Gutter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ravenna,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or gutter fixes or cleaning in Ravenna, local contractors typically charge between $150 and $400. These projects usually involve clearing debris or sealing small leaks and are common in routine maintenance. Costs tend to stay within this middle range for most standard repairs.
Partial Gutter Replacement - Replacing sections of damaged gutters often falls in the $600-$1,200 range depending on the length and materials used. Many homeowners opt for partial replacements when only certain areas are compromised, which keeps costs moderate. Larger, more complex partial projects can approach $2,000.
Full Gutter System Replacement - A complete gutter replacement in Ravenna typically costs between $2,500 and $5,000, depending on the size of the property and the type of gutters selected. Most full replacements fall into the middle of this range, with larger or custom systems reaching higher prices.
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, more intricate gutter installations or custom designs can exceed $5,000, especially for historic or multi-story homes. These projects are less common and often involve specialized materials or features that increase overall cost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that gutter replacement is needed for a church building? Indicators include persistent leaks, overflowing gutters during rain, visible damage or sagging, and rust or corrosion on existing gutters.
What types of gutters are commonly used for church buildings? Common options include aluminum, steel, and vinyl gutters,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ities suitable for church structures.
How do local contractors handle gutter replacement on churches? They typically assess the building's specific needs, remove old gutters safely, and install new gutters with proper support and drainage considerations.
Are there maintenance requirements after gutter replacement on a church? Regular inspections and cleaning are recommended to ensure proper function and to prevent blockages or damage over time.
